mgversion2>datura mgv2_77 | Pen is Envy | 07_14. Theme based on a quote from Margaret Atwood's The Handmaid's Tale. "The pen between my fingers is sensuous, alive almost, I can feel its power, the power of the words it contains. Pen Is Envy, Aunt Lydia would say, quoting another Center motto, warning us away from such objects. And they were right, it is envy. Just holding it is envy. I envy the Commander his pen. It's one more thing I would like to steal." Contents: Inside illustrations by Alexandra Bouge, Sophie Brassart, Ira Joel Haber, Flora Michèle Marin & Norman Olson Paul Beckman, Alexandra Bouge, Sophie Brassart, Chloé Charpentier, Denis Emorine, Ron Fischman, Mathias Jansson, Steve F. Klepetar, Roger Leatherwood, Karla Linn Merrifield, Peter O'Neill, Norman Olson, Emeniano Acain SomozaJr, J.J. Steinfeld, Marisa Urgo, Yvette Vasseur, Walter Ruhlmann, Daniel N. Flanagan, Amber Decker, Patrice Maltaverne, Marie Lecrivain
